About Jibble Group
We’re a scale‑up in the Workforce Management space that has fully embraced remote work since 2017. Headquartered in London, UK, we have close to 80 staff in 16 different countries.
We launched PayrollPanda.my and Jibble.io in 2016 and 2017 respectively. PayrollPanda has become Malaysia’s leading cloud payroll software, and Jibble an award‑winning time clock solution, each with thousands of paying customers.
About The Job
We're looking to translate (and occasionally write) from English to Dutch content related to time‑tracking, such as reviews of HR software, time‑tracking law articles, etc.
Your responsibilities will include:
- You must be both creative and analytical
- Produce error‑free and quality content that fits the company’s style guidelines
Who are we looking for:
- Demonstrates strong oral and written communication skills in Dutch with comprehensive editing and proofreading skills.
- Excellent time management, organisational skills and the ability to multitask and prioritize.
